IDR is seeking a Network Support Engineer to join one of our top clients in Lawrenceville, GA. This role is pivotal in ensuring the seamless operation of network infrastructure by focusing on the organization and documentation of network cabling. Position Overview/Responsibilities for the Network Support Engineer:
- Document and update network cabling information, focusing on copper and fiber connections within data closets.
- Utilize Microsoft Excel to maintain accurate records of network closet configurations.
- Employ a laptop and label printer to create and apply labels for fiber patch panels and cables.
- Communicate any issues or concerns to the Director of Enterprise Infrastructure.
- Perform light cleanup and cable management to ensure organized network closets.
Required Skills for Network Support Engineer:
- Ability to read and interpret existing network and equipment labels with precision.
- Basic proficiency in Microsoft Office tools, including OneDrive, Teams, Excel, and Word.
- Understanding of fiber cabling types and connector types such as ST, SC, LC, MPO, and RJ45.
- Capability to trace and identify active cables in use.
